How popular is the name Flonnie?

Flonnie is a unique baby name in United States, it had been in use since 1889 and was last seen in 1961, during its 66 years of usage, it was able to reach the top 900 names.

In 1911, it achieved its highest ever ranking of 853 on girl names chart when 40 babies were named Flonnie. There are over 1065 babies that have been given the name Flonnie in United States.

Also, Flonnie is a familiar name in Malawi. At least, 1000 people globally have been given the name as per our estimate.
